E Homo sapiens | Putative ATP-dependent RNA helicase TDRD12 [TDRD12]
Description | tudor domain containing 12 [Source:HGNC Symbol;Acc:HGNC:25044]; transcript_id=ENST00000444215.6 |
Organism | HUMAN - Homo sapiens |
Locus | [19]: 32720073 ... 32821183 |
Number of exons | 28 |
Exons | join(32720073..32720096, 32731725..32731883, 32738856..32738992, 32742781..32742900, 32748476..32748531, 32749784..32749869, 32755992..32756181, 32757038..32757130, 32772753..32772850, 32773456..32773532, 32777149..32777229, 32790531..32790591, 32790964..32791068, 32794628..32794813, 32797735..32797891, 32798308..32798435, 32800167..32800358, 32800644..32800772, 32801756..32801873, 32802656..32802789, 32802922..32803142, 32807549..32807648, 32810093..32810277, 32811210..32811420, 32813684..32813776, 32815448..32815620, 32818089..32818157, 32821033..32821183) |